知识问答

针对大型网站你有哪些优化的方案(大型网站优化策略)

大型网站优化是一项系统性工程,需从架构设计、性能提升、用户体验、安全防护等多维度综合施策。随着互联网流量爆发式增长和技术迭代加速,传统单服务器架构已无法满足高并发、低延迟的业务需求。现代大型网站优化需遵循“分层治理、动静分离、智能调度”的核心原则,通过分布式架构、边缘计算、智能缓存等技术构建弹性扩展能力,同时结合用户行为分析实现精准资源调配。本文将从技术架构、性能优化、内容管理、安全防御四大层面展开,提出12项具体优化方案,并通过数据对比验证不同策略的实施效果。

一、技术架构优化方案

大型网站架构优化需解决高可用性、弹性扩展和低延迟三大核心问题,采用分层架构设计可显著提升系统稳定性。

优化方向传统架构微服务架构Serverless架构
部署复杂度单体应用部署简单需容器编排和服务注册中心自动扩缩容,零运维
故障恢复时间全量重启(分钟级)单个服务重启(秒级)即时恢复(毫秒级)
资源利用率闲置资源占比高(40-60%)动态分配(提升30-50%)按需计费(降低成本40%+)

通过对比可见,Serverless架构在资源利用率和故障恢复方面优势显著,但需结合业务波峰特征选择合适模式。对于核心交易模块建议采用微服务架构,而营销活动等突发流量场景适用Serverless方案。

二、性能优化深度策略

性能优化需建立全链路监控体系,重点突破网络传输、计算处理、存储访问三大瓶颈环节。

优化技术实施成本提速效果适用场景
HTTP/3协议中等(需TLS 1.3支持)首屏加载提速40%移动端网页浏览
WebP图像编码低(CDN支持即启用)带宽节省35-50%图片密集型页面
Redis缓存集群高(需架构改造)数据库查询降低70%高频数据读取场景

实际测试表明,组合使用HTTP/3+WebP可使页面加载时间缩短至传统模式的38%。对于电商类网站,引入Redis缓存后商品详情页响应时间可从800ms降至250ms,显著提升转化率。

三、内容管理优化体系

内容优化需建立智能分发机制,实现个性化推荐与高效管理的平衡。

管理维度传统CMS头部化CMSAI驱动CMS
内容生产效率人工编辑主导模板化批量生成AI自动生成(占比30%+)
推荐准确率依赖人工分类基于规则匹配深度学习模型(CTR提升2.3倍)
运营成本人力密集型半自动化处理智能化运维(成本降低60%)

某门户网站实测数据显示,采用AI驱动CMS后,热门内容生产效率提升4倍,用户停留时长增加120%。但需注意冷启动阶段的数据积累和模型调优,建议初期采用混合推荐策略。

四、安全防护强化方案

安全防护需构建纵深防御体系,重点防范DDoS攻击、数据泄露和爬虫骚扰。

td>反爬策略
防御层级基础防护增强防护智能防护
DDoS防护静态阈值过滤动态流量清洗行为画像分析(误封率降低80%)
数据安全基础HTTPS字段级加密同态加密(性能损耗<15%)
IP频率限制JS混淆+验证码设备指纹识别(拦截效率95%+)

金融类网站实践表明,智能防护体系可使恶意请求识别准确率提升至99.2%,同时正常用户误伤率控制在0.3%以下。建议结合业务特点配置多级防护策略,如电商大促期间启用最高防护等级。

五、综合优化效果评估

实施优化方案后需建立量化评估体系,持续监测关键指标变化。某日活千万级门户网站优化前后数据对比如下:

核心指标优化前优化后提升幅度
首页加载时间4.2s1.1s74%
服务器峰值负载92% CPU65% CPU29%
日均拦截攻击12万次40万次233%
内容生产成本¥85万/月¥32万/月63%

数据表明,系统性优化可使网站综合性能提升2-3倍,安全防护能力增强4倍以上。但需注意优化措施的渐进性,建议分阶段实施,每阶段设置明确验收标准。